Superqq Neutral Newbie December 31, 2007 Share December 31, 2007 Friend FYI, Honda began research into small sized business jets in the late 1980s, using engines from other manufacturers. The Honda MH02, an organic matrix composite prototype, was fabricated and assembled at Mississippi State University's Raspet Flight Research Laboratory in the late 1980s and early 1990s. This research led to Honda developing its own small turbofan jet engine, the HF120 in 1999. The HF120, which was developed with GE-Aviation under the GE Honda partnership, was test-flown on a Cessna Citation and on a modified Boeing 727-100. The engine features a single fan, a two-stage compressor and a two-stage turbine. Further design testing on wing shape and design were done on a Lockheed T-33 Shooting Star, modified by AVTEL Services, Inc, and flight tested at the Mojave Airport. GE Honda Aero Engines LLC (or GE Honda) is a Cincinnati, Ohio-based joint venture between GE-Aviation and Honda Aero.
